Frequently Asked Questions about Imperial Beach
How much are Studio apartments in Imperial Beach?
There are currently 178 Studio Apartments in Imperial Beach with rent ranges from $1,850 to $2,295 with an average price of $2,008.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Imperial Beach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Imperial Beach ranges from $1,795 to $3,095 with an average monthly rent of $2,228.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Imperial Beach c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Imperial Beach range from $2,075 to $3,395.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,606.
How expensive are Imperial Beach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 80 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Imperial Beach on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$3,100 to $6,900 - averaging $4,035 for the location.
